Every circuit is a balance of recovery, cost, and operational risk. HPSA technology improves that balance.
The HPSA platform enhances selective liberation at coarser grind sizes—reducing overgrinding, lowering energy use, and improving downstream recovery. By targeting mineral boundaries instead of indiscriminately shrinking particles, HPSA units increase concentrate grade while minimizing excess fines and reagent demand.

DEMONSTRATED PERFORMANCE AT COMMERCIAL & PILOT SCALE
Across more than 150 ore campaigns and commercial installations, the HPSA platform has delivered measurable improvements in grade, recovery, and operating efficiency across multiple mineral systems.
Recovery Improvements
+2% to +44% recovery gains demonstrated across sulfides, industrial minerals, and tailings systems.
Grade Enhancement
Up to +25% improvement in concentrate grade at coarser grind sizes.
Energy Intensity
3–10 kWh per ton operating range, with no grinding media.
Wear Cost
<$2 per ton in wear components.
System Uptime
95% operational availability with integrated bypass capability.

Tailings often contain recoverable value due to incomplete liberation in legacy circuits. HPSA technology provides a modular, mechanical pathway to unlock that value—without overgrinding or major infrastructure changes.
